Watermelon Agua Fresca

This refreshing drink is served by roadside vendors all over Mexico. Not too much fruit, not too much sugar, just a beautiful way to quench your thirst on a summer day. From 'EatingWell.com' and posted for ZWT5. NOTE: Prep time DOES NOT include 4 hour chill time. Show more

Ready In: 15 mins

Serves: 10

Yields: 10 1 cup servings

Directions

  1. Combine half the watermelon, half the water and half the sugar in a blender; puree.
  2. Pour through a coarse strainer into a large container.
  3. Repeat with the remaining watermelon, water and sugar.
  4. Stir in lime juice.
  5. Refrigerate until well chilled, about 4 hours.
  6. To serve, stir in club soda (or seltzer) and garnish with lime.
  7. MAKE AHEAD TIP: Prepare through Step 1, cover and refrigerate for up to 2 days.
